涂梨平,龚良雄,曹庆安
(江西核工业测绘院,江西 南昌 330038)
一种利用FME及地块四至信息对界址线类别批量赋值的方法
涂梨平,龚良雄,曹庆安
(江西核工业测绘院,江西 南昌 330038)
在农村土地承包经营权确权登记过程中,需要利用已有的地块四至信息对界址线类别进行赋值,但大多数数据入库软件是通过人工判读界址线类别,然后手动输入到界址线属性表当中的,不仅工作量巨大,且不可避免会造成输入错误。本文利用FME WorkBench2015软件,首先提取了每宗地块的东、南、西、北4个方向的权属线,然后分析了权属线与地块界址线之间的空间拓扑关系,以便对界址线类别进行批量赋值;通过在实际生产项目中的应用,证明了本文所采用的方法是可行的、实用的、有效的。
农村土地承包经营权;地块四至;界址线;FME;拓扑关系
农村土地承包经营权指的是农村集体经济组织成员或农村集体经济组织以外的单位或个人依法对其承包经营的集体所有或国家所有由农民集体使用的农村土地享有占有、使用和收益的权利[1]。开展农村土地承包经营权确权登记工作,实现对土地承包合同、登记簿和权属证书管理的信息化,加强土地承包经营权确权登记颁证成果的应用,方便群众查询,利于服务管理,可更好地服务于现代农业和新农村建设[2]。对土地承包经营权的确权颁证确保了农户的合法权益,促进了土地流转,为全面落实十八大“发挥市场在资源配置中的决定性作用”提供了基础性支撑[3]。宗地四至是指一宗地4个方位与相邻土地的交接界线,一般填写四邻的土地所有者或使用单位和个人的名称,特殊情况下填写沟渠、道路、行数等属性信息。界址线指的是承包地块的边界线,根据中华人民共和国《农村土地承包经营权确权登记数据库规范》,需要对每宗地块的界址线属性结构描述表(见表1、表2)进行赋值。针对此问题,本文提出了利用FME及地块四至信息对界址线类别批量赋值的方法。
除界址线类别字段之外,其他字段信息可以通过上海飞未信息技术有限公司所研发的51建库软件自动赋值,但该软件未能正确处理界址线类别字段,且软件将该字段统一赋值为01,显然结果是不正确的。在农村土地确权项目中地块数量少则几万,多则几十万,界址线类别若依靠人工判读、逐条输入,虽然数据的准确性能得到一定程度的保证,但工作量会非常巨大。
表1 界址线属性结构
表2 界址线类别代码
因此,本文以贵州省黔东南苗族侗族自治州剑河县农村土地承包经营权确权登记项目为例,研究基于FME及地块四至信息对界址线类别批量赋值的方法。该方法已经应用到所有笔者所在单位承担的农村土地承包经营权确权登记项目中,并且取得了一定的成果。
FME(feature manipulate engine)是一套完整的访问空间数据的解决方案,可用于读写、存储和转换各种空间数据[4]。它能实现各类GIS及CAD格式的数据间相互转换,以FME为中心实现了超过100种GIS及CAD空间数据格式如DWG、DXF、DGN、ArcInfo Corvage、Shape File、ArcSDE、Oracle SDO等的相互转换;它可以独立地直接浏览各种格式的空间数据,并同时浏览图形、属性和坐标数据;它提供为数据转换进行自定义的图形化界面,能够可视化定义从原始数据到目标数据的图形与属性的对应关系;它可以将数据转换与丰富的GIS数据处理功能结合在一起,如坐标系统转换、叠加分析、相交运算、构造闭合多边形、属性合并等;它提供了FME Plug-in Builder API、FME Object API等应用程序接口,用户可以为FME扩展新的数据格式,通过这些接口将FME嵌入到自己的应用系统中,实现方便的应用集成;它支持海量数据处理,大型的数据转换通过编写脚本及批处理模式高效运行,即使输入数据多达数千个甚至上万个文件。李逵[5]通过利用FME转换系统,提出了一套完善的由原始CAD成果数据转换到GIS建库标准数据的解决方案,并有效地应用到实际的数据库建设项目中。杨娜娜等[6]提出了一套较为完善的CAD规划成果数据GIS建库的方案和技术实现流程,最终完成了CAD数据到GIS数据的无缝转换,真正解决了异构数据同化的问题。薄伟伟等[7]提出了一种CAD数据向GIS数据的转换方案,该转换方案能够避免CAD数据向GIS数据转换中的信息丢失,提高了数据转换的效率和准确性。李瑞霞等[8]以FME为转换平台,构建了基于语义转换的GIS到CAD数据的“无损”转换模型。
通过在FME Workbench2015软件中定制数据处理流程模块,只需要读取待处理的数据,就能够可视化地提取原始地块四至信息至界址线类别中。整个数据处理流程模块如图1所示。
3.1 技术原理
本文具体利用地理信息系统的空间拓扑关系分析及叠置分析原理,首先提取每宗地块的东、南、西、北4个方向的权属线,通过判断界址线与4个方向权属线的空间拓扑关系,结合地块四至信息对界址线类别进行批量赋值。GIS中空间关系主要包含方向关系、拓扑关系和度量关系。其中,拓扑关系是最基本也是最重要的关系,在GIS空间推理与应用中占有重要的地位[9-10],它描述的是自然界地理对象的空间位置关系,即基本的空间目标点、线、面之间的邻接、关联和包含关系[11]。拓扑关系的判定是地理信息系统中进行空间查询、空间分析、空间推理等操作的基础[12]。叠置分析是地理信息系统中用来提取空间隐含信息的方法之一,它将代表不同主题的各个数据层面进行叠置产生一个新的数据层面,叠置结果综合了原来两个或多个层面要素所具有的属性[13]。根据操作要素的不同,叠置分析可分为点与多边形叠加、线与多边形叠加、多边形与多边形叠加;根据操作形式的不同,叠置分析可分为图层擦除、识别叠加、交集操作、对称区别、图层合并、修正更新和空间联合[14]。
图1 数据处理流程模块
3.2 技术流程
本文首先利用FME的BoundsExtractor转换器获取每宗地块的最小外接矩形,利用Chopper转换器提取地块所有节点;然后利用CoordinateExtractor、AttributeCreator、Counter、Sorter、Tester等转换器计算与外接矩形4个角最近的4个坐标点;再利用FeatureMerger、Tester、Sorter、PointConnector转换器将位于4个坐标点之间所有的节点依次连接,得到地块东、南、西、北4个方向上的权属线,利用LineOnAreaOverlayer转换器过滤掉地块之间共用界址线;最后利用SpatialRelator、Tester、AttributeCreator转换器对界址线类别批量赋值。其中,LineOnAreaOverlayer、SpatialRelator转换器参数设置如图2、图3所示。总体技术流程如图4所示。
图2 LineOnAreaOverlayer转换器参数设置
在地块4个方向权属线提取子流程中具体以地块数据中地块A为例说明,如图5所示。首先获取地块A的最小外接矩形;然后提取地块A的所有节点;再计算出节点中与外接矩形4个角最近的点;最后依次可以得到地块A4个方向上的权属线。
图3 SpatialRelator转换器参数设置
图4 界址线类别批量赋值技术流程
图5 地块4个方向权属线提取
由于不同地块之间可能存在共用的界址线,因此处理时应把共有的界址线提取出来,地块共用界址线的类别必为田埂,因此可对它们进行统一赋值,最后将非共用界址线与地块4个方向权属线进行空间拓扑关系分析。如某界址线与地块北方向的权属线存在包含、等于、重叠、里面关系时,界址线的_related_candidates属性值大于1,该界址线类别与地块北至信息相对应,相应的可以对该界址线类别进行赋值。若界址线与地块北方向的权属线不存在包含、等于、重叠、里面关系时,界址线的_related_candidates属性值为0,因此可以利用Tester转换器过滤出不与地块北方向的权属线相对应的界址线,再与地块东方向的权属线进行拓扑关系分析;若界址线的_related_candidates属性值大于1,该界址线类别与地块东至信息相对应,相应的可以对该界址线类别进行赋值,利用Tester转换器过滤出不与地块东方向的权属线相对应的界址线,再次与地块南方向的权属线进行拓扑关系分析,直至所有的界址线与地块4个方向的权属线完成拓扑关系分析为止。
通过提取地块4个方向的权属线、过滤地块共用界址线、4个方向的权属线和非共用界址线的拓扑空间关系分析,可对地块的界址线类别进行统一赋值,最终的输出成果如图6所示。在输出成果中,界址线类别(JZXLB)字段的值不再统设为01,该字段会根据界址线与地块某方向的权属线相对应原则进行属性赋值。若该界址线与地块北方向的全属性存在包含、等于、重叠、里面关系时,则该界址线与地块北方向的权属线相对应,利用AttributeCreator转换器可将字段的属性值与地块四至信息中的地块北至相对应。以界址线与地块北方向的权属线相对应为例,AttributeCreator转换器参数条件定义如图7所示。
图6 最终输出成果
图7 AttributeCreator转换器参数条件定义
在实际的数据生产过程中,大多数情况下都需要借助专业的GIS软件,以生产符合国家规范要求的数据。然而由于软件设计和研发的原因,在某些情况下专业GIS软件所处理的数据不能完全满足国家规范要求,如笔者所在单位采购的51建库软件,对界址线类别不能根据实际地块四至信息赋值,只能统一赋值为01。针对此类问题,可以在51建库软件平台上进行二次开发,但二次开发有以下几个弊端:①需要开发人员对特定平台的接口掌握学习,耗时长;②软件平台进行升级时,一旦数据格式或接口改变,二次开发成果可能不适用于新平台;③专业GIS软件众多,如ArcGIS、MapGIS、SuperMap等,不同生产项目所使用的GIS软件也不同,这就需要研发人员的二次开发能力不局限于特定GIS软件平台。FME以其对各类数据格式的广泛支持及多个函数模块自由组合的特点,已经被广泛地应用于GIS的生产过程中,既可以分阶段完成数据的提取、转换、编辑、集成、拓扑检查及发布共享,还可以作为整套方案的定制工具[15],解决开发中存在的一系列问题。本文以贵州省黔东南苗族侗族自治州剑河县农村土地承包经营权确权登记项目为例,证明了本文基于FME及地块四至信息对界址线类别批量赋值方法的可行性、实用性、有效性,能将该方法应用于所有其所承接的农村土地承包经营权确权登记项目中,并且能在实际项目中提高数据的生产效率。
[1] 张耀广. 农村土地承包经营权登记确权工作探讨[J]. 商品与质量, 2016(1):21-23.
[2] 乔国娟. 如何做好农村土地承包经营权确权登记颁证工作[J]. 吉林农业, 2015(5):76-76.
[3] 郑晓华. 农村土地承包经营权确权登记颁证项目应用[J]. 测绘通报, 2015(9):139-140.
[4] 熊登亮, 贵仁义, 赵俊三,等. 基于FME的空间数据处理实现[J]. 测绘, 2007, 30(3):118-121.
[5] 李逵. FME在基础地理信息数据库建设中的应用研究[J]. 测绘通报, 2016(3):115-117.
[6] 杨娜娜, 张新长, 黄健锋. CAD规划成果数据GIS建库的技术与研究[J]. 测绘通报, 2015(6):44-48.
[7] 薄伟伟, 丁俊杰, 王爱萍. CAD数据向GIS数据的转换方法[J]. 地理空间信息, 2013, 11(6):94-95.
[8] 李瑞霞, 杨敏, 邓喀中. 基于FME的GIS到CAD数据“无损”转换[J]. 测绘通报, 2009(5):55-59.
[9] ZHAN F B. Approximate Analysis of Binary Topological Relations Between Geographic Regions with Indeterminate Boundaries[J]. Soft Computing, 1998, 2(2):28-34.
[10] 陈军, 赵仁亮. GIS空间关系的基本问题与研究进展[J]. 测绘学报, 1999,28(2):95-102.
[11] 邱洪钢. ArcGIS Engine地理信息系统开发从入门到精通[M]. 北京:人民邮电出版社, 2013.
[12] 郭庆胜, 杜晓初. 模糊面元素空间拓扑关系抽象化方法研究[J]. 测绘学报, 2004, 33(4):307-310.
[13] 沈意浪. 基于GIS空间叠置分析的城市择房研究[J]. 数字技术与应用, 2012(4):62-62.
[14] 邬伦, 刘瑜, 张晶,等. 地理信息系统——原理方法和应用[M]. 北京:科学出版社, 2002:47-72.
[15] 夏兴东, 陈娟红. FME 在数据转换中的应用[J]. 现代测绘, 2011, 34(3):62-63.
A Batch Assignment Method of Category of Boundary Line Based on FME and Information of Relative Location of Adjoining Parcels
TU Liping,GONG Liangxiong,CAO Qing’an
(Jiangxi Nuclear Surveying and Mapping Institute, Nanchang 330038, China)
In the process of registration of rural land contractual management right, it is necessary to use the existing information of relative location of adjoining parcels to assign the category of boundary line. But most of the data storage software is operated by manual interpretation of the category of boundary line, and then manually entered the category of boundary line into the boundary line attribute table. Manual operation is not only a huge workload, but also inevitably lead to input errors. This paper takes advantage of FME WorkBench 2015 software. Firstly, it extracts the ownership lines of the east, south, west and north of each parcel, and then analyzes the spatial topological relations between the ownership lines and the boundary line of parcel, in order to carry on the batch assignment to the boundary line type. Through the application in the actual production project, it is proved that this method is feasible, practical and effective.
right of rural land contractual management; relative location of adjoining parcels; boundary line; FME; topological relations
涂梨平,龚良雄,曹庆安.一种利用FME及地块四至信息对界址线类别批量赋值的方法[J].测绘通报,2017(5):105-109.
10.13474/j.cnki.11-2246.2017.0165.
2016-10-24
涂梨平(1981—),女,硕士,高级工程师,从事测绘、地理信息、遥感工作。E-mail:tlp816@qq.com
P23
A
0494-0911(2017)05-0105-05